Aggie98 Posted September 12, 2015 Share Posted September 12, 2015 It was a 10-9 ballgame with 4:30 left in the 4th.... Kilgore's Jaqorius Smith ripped off TD runs of 45, 65, and 75 yds on Kilgore's last 3 possessions. Â Smith finished with 293 rushing yds on the night. Had a big feeling Smith would go off tonight. Feed the beast with carries and the beast delivers. Lol. 293 yds is pretty impressive considering he only had 40 yds on 10 carries at halftime. This was Jaqorius's 2nd best game of his career and I've got it at #5 on Kilgore's single-game rushing record list since I've lived here (2003)..... Â 1. Frank Reddic, Jr., 363 yds against Marshall, 2008 Â 2. LaDarius Anthony, 345 yds against Palestine, 2009 Â 3. Frank Reddic, Jr., 334 yds against Whitehouse, 2008 Â 4. Jaqorius Smith, 300 yds against Corpus Christi - Flour Bluff, 2014 Â 5. Jaqorius Smith, 293 yds against Pine Tree, 2015 Â 6. Keith Gilliam, 291 yds against Lamarque, 2004 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
